Explore how unresolved conflict quietly erodes teams and discover practical frameworks for addressing it early through clear and constructive leadership practices in this 32-minute conference talk. Examine the concept of "conflict debt" - the unspoken tension, silent resentment, and avoided difficult decisions that accumulate interest over time in the form of bottlenecks, misalignment, and team dysfunction. Learn to recognize how conflict debt manifests in technical and cross-functional teams, understand how unresolved issues silently slow down delivery, trust, and morale, and identify what prevents leaders from addressing conflict directly. Discover practical language and frameworks for navigating conflict constructively without fear, and gain strategies for creating a culture that normalizes healthy conflict without descending into dysfunction. Drawing from Liane Davey's conflict debt concept and years of engineering leadership experience, this presentation provides essential tools for leaders who have experienced meetings where true agreement wasn't reached or where silence was mistaken for consensus.
